[NEWSboard IBMi Forum]
  1. #1
    Registriert seit
    Jan 2002
    Beiträge
    32

    Question Berechtigung physische versus logische Datei

    Hallo zusammen,

    mal angenommen, wir haben eine physische Datei, z.B. mit den drei Feldern Namen, Geburtsdatum, Gehalt. Nur wenige Benutzer sollen ins Gehalt einblicken, alle jedoch Name und Geburtsdatum. Eigentlich dachte ich, man kann eine logische Datei drüberlegen (Sicht) und dieser neue Berechtigungen erteilen. Allerdings funktioniert die logische nur dann, wenn Sie auch für die physische berechtigt ist... letztendlich macht doch so eine Berechtigungsteuerung der logischen Dateien überhaupt keinen Sinn ?!? Denn wenn der User keine Kommandozeile hat, um STRQRY abzusetzen, bleiben ihm ohnehin nur die Programme zur Auswahl, die ich ihm anbiete - und da brauche ich ihm ja kein Gehalt vor die Nase führen. Ich habe in der ganzen Angelegenheit doch hoffentlich irgendwas übersehen ???

    Grüße, Andreas

    P.S.: Ich weiß, es gibt unter SQL Feldberechtigung, aber lassen wir die mal außen vor, möchte nur etwas theoretisieren (Schließlich gab's Feldberechtigungen nicht schon immer)

  2. #2
    Registriert seit
    Apr 2001
    Beiträge
    61

    Post

    Hallo Andreas,

    wenn ich dein Problem richtig verstanden habe, dann hast du eine PFile deren Felder nicht jeder Benutzer zur Verfügung haben soll!
    Mein Vorschlag (ohne Berechtigungssteuerung)

    Leg über die Pfile eine Lfile, in der nur die Felder enthalten sind, die die entsprechenden User auch sehen dürfen!
    Das einzige worauf du dabei achten musst ist, das das Satzformat anders heisst als in der PFile.

  3. #3
    Registriert seit
    Aug 2001
    Beiträge
    54

    Post

    Hallo Andreas,

    Du kannst den Benutzern die Objektrechte an der physischen Datei entziehen, aber die Datenrechte lassen. Dann ist ein Zugriff über eine logische Datei (in dem Fall mit Feldauswahl) möglich, über die physische Datei nicht mehr.

    Also zum Beispiel von der Berechtigung *CHANGE aus gesehen *OBJOPR entziehen.


    Heinz

  4. #4
    Registriert seit
    Jan 2002
    Beiträge
    32

    Talking

    A-Ha!!! Genau das mit der Objektberechtigung ist die Lösung. Clever... Vielen Dank!

Similar Threads

  1. Physische Datei mit mit vielen logischen Dateien
    By TARASIK in forum IBM i Hauptforum
    Antworten: 7
    Letzter Beitrag: 01-09-06, 17:25
  2. Query: logische Datei wird nicht verwendet
    By RolfSalzer in forum IBM i Hauptforum
    Antworten: 3
    Letzter Beitrag: 28-10-05, 14:27
  3. WDSC - physische Datei ersetzen
    By zannaleer in forum NEWSboard Programmierung
    Antworten: 0
    Letzter Beitrag: 24-05-05, 14:19
  4. Sortierung Logische Datei
    By Stefan12 in forum IBM i Hauptforum
    Antworten: 2
    Letzter Beitrag: 12-05-05, 14:57
  5. Logische Datei mit Gruppierungen
    By THK in forum NEWSboard Programmierung
    Antworten: 4
    Letzter Beitrag: 15-12-04, 07:40

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•